std::ostringstream parmStream;
char parmName[1024];
    THTTPUrl::Encode(parmName, pParm->Name().c_str(), 1024);

//我要添加的PARAMNAME的价值,parmStream工作B4时parmName是一个字符串,但现在没有OBV

parmStream << "&" << parmName + "=";

给我以下.. 错误:类型\ u2018char的无效操作数[1024] \ u2019和\ u2018const炭[2] \ u2019二进制\ u2018operator + \ u2019

预先干杯的帮助

有帮助吗?

解决方案

尝试

parmStream << "&" << parmName << "=";

我没有检查你的代码,但它看起来像错误指向您要添加的“=”,以一个标准的C字符串的事实。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top